WebMar 15, 2024 · After opening gefilte fish or once opened, these goods should be kept refrigerated and consumed within 3 to 5 days of opening. The gefilte fish may be frozen, and it will last longer if it is coated with jell or liquid while in the freezer…. Cooked fish that has been left over should be consumed within three to four days. WebBuy 2 lbs of fish filets. Grind the fish. Mix the ground fish with a bit of oil and matzah meal. Form balls of this mixture (wet your hands first). Boil the fish balls in a broth made by boiling some vegetables in water. Serve with horseradish.
